Maximum Working Hours Per Day In Malaysia . The maximum working hours for workers have been reduced from 48 hours per week to 45 hours per week, effective 1 january 2023, excluding meal breaks. It also sets the daily work hour limit to 12 hours on any given day, including overtime. The standard work week in malaysia is 40 hours, with employees generally working eight hours per workday. The maximum weekly working hours have been reduced from 48 hours per week to 45 hours per week. As per the act, an employee’s normal working time should not exceed more than 45 hours per week. The amendment act 2022 reduces the maximum working hours per week to 45 hours, for all employees under the scope of ea 1955. Employees are also entitled to 30 minutes of rest after 5 consecutive hours of work.
